Top reasons to visit Trogir Old Town
- Stunning Architecture: Trogir Old Town boasts remarkable medieval structures, showcasing a blend of Romanesque and Renaissance styles.
- Vibrant Markets: Explore local markets filled with fresh produce, handmade crafts, and traditional Croatian delicacies.
- Rich History: As a UNESCO World Heritage site, Trogir is steeped in history, with numerous ancient churches and monuments to discover.
- Beautiful Beaches: Enjoy sun-soaked days at Trogir Beach or take a stroll along Trogir Bay for stunning coastal views.
- Friendly Atmosphere: Experience the warm hospitality of locals while immersing yourself in the charming, family-friendly vibe.

Best time to go to Trogir Old Town
The best time to visit Trogir Old Town is dependant on what kind of holiday you are seeking. August is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are high and weather is sunny with no rain (dry). January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are low and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.

The nearest major airports for your trip to Trogir Old Town
When visiting Trogir Old Town, you can conveniently fly into Split Airport (SPU), located 4.8km away.
